The Pension Protection Fund in Croydon is seeking an experienced FP&A Analyst to support the Head of Financial Planning & Analysis. In this role, you'll improve planning and reporting capabilities while maximizing value from finance systems.
The position requires a qualified accountant with strong analytical skills, and proficiency in Excel, as well as experience with financial planning tools like Oracle EPM.

How to prepare for a job interview at Pension Protection Fund
✨Know Your Numbers
As an FP&A Analyst, you'll be expected to have a strong grasp of financial metrics. Brush up on key financial concepts and be ready to discuss how you've used data to drive insights in your previous roles. This will show your analytical skills and your ability to maximise value from finance systems.
✨Excel Like a Pro
Since proficiency in Excel is crucial for this role, make sure you can demonstrate your skills during the interview. Prepare to discuss specific functions or tools you've used in Excel, such as pivot tables or advanced formulas, and how they helped you in financial planning and reporting.
✨Familiarise with Oracle EPM
If you have experience with Oracle EPM or similar financial planning tools, be ready to talk about it. If not, do some research on its functionalities and how it integrates into financial planning processes. Showing that you're proactive about learning can really impress the interviewers.
